Coolkyousinnjya [1] (クール教信者, Kūrukyōshinja) is a Japanese manga artist known for the series Miss Kobayashi's Dragon Maid, I Can't Understand What My Husband Is Saying, and Komori-san Can't Decline. [2]
In 2011, Coolkyousinnjya published the first volume of I Can't Understand What My Husband Is Saying. [3] An anime adaptation aired from October to December 2014, [4] with a second season airing from April to June 2015. [5]
In April 2012, Coolkyousinnjya released the first chapter of Komori-san Can't Decline. [6] An anime adaptation aired from October to December 2015. [7]
On 10 May 2013, the first Miss Kobayashi's Dragon Maid chapter was published [8] in Japanese, and the first English volume was published on 18 October 2016. [9] As of December 2021, 11 manga volumes have been published. [10] Miss Kobayashi's Dragon Maid also has four spin-off series, including Miss Kobayashi's Dragon Maid: Kanna's Daily Life [11] and Miss Kobayashi's Dragon Maid: Elma's Office Lady Diary. [12] Miss Kobayashi's Dragon Maid has over 1.2 million copies in print worldwide as of February 2018. [13] It received an anime adaptation in early 2017, [14] with a second season airing in 2021. [15]
Coolkyousinnjya is also writing Peach Boy Riverside and illustrating The Idaten Deities Know Only Peace, which both had anime adaptations premiere in July 2021. [16] [17]
